
KWS Publishers, Inc. is a publisher of scholarly, reference and fiction works. It was founded in 2009, and is based in Chicago with an office in London. Its three key publishing development themes are: revised and updated editions of important works originally published by the English-speaking world’s most prominent museum, university press and trade/academic publishers (these editions are created both for libraries and for the book trade); new fiction and, via our Astor Place Genre Fiction series, a reintroduction of noteworthy, out-of-print fiction of various genres; and new scholarly monographs and reference product, including single-volume reference tools for students and multi-volume academic reference works for libraries.
The founders of KWS—George Walsh and James C. Hart—are experienced in the information and scholarly publishing markets, having previously founded St. James Press and Fitzroy Dearborn Publishers. Those companies won an unprecedented number of industry accolades and awards for their work, more than any other publisher in the U.S. or U.K.
